What is a crypto honeypot and why is it utilised?
Sensible contracts applications across a decentralized network of nodes can be executed on modern day blockchains like Ethereum. Good contracts are getting to be extra well-known and important, building them a more interesting concentrate on for attackers. Many smart contracts have been focused by hackers in the latest years.
Nevertheless, a new craze appears to be attaining traction particularly, attackers are no extended seeking for inclined contracts but are adopting a more proactive technique. Instead, they purpose to trick their victims into falling into traps by sending out contracts that look to be vulnerable but comprise hidden traps. Honeypots are a time period utilised to describe this special form of deal. But, what is a honeypot crypto trap?
Honeypots are sensible contracts that show up to have a design situation that allows an arbitrary user to drain Ether (Ethereum’s native currency) from the deal if the person sends a certain quantity of Ether to the contract beforehand. Even so, when the user attempts to exploit this clear flaw, a trapdoor opens a 2nd, yet unknown, protecting against the ether draining from succeeding. So, what does a honeypot do?
The goal is that the consumer focuses solely on the seen weak point and ignores any signs that the deal has a 2nd vulnerability. Honeypot assaults perform mainly because men and women are routinely very easily deceived, just as in other sorts of fraud. As a outcome, men and women can’t constantly quantify threat in the facial area of their avarice and assumptions. So, are honeypots unlawful?
How does a honeypot fraud get the job done?
In crypto cyber attacks like honeypots, the user’s cash will be imprisoned, and only the honeypot creator (attacker) will be equipped to get well them. A honeypot commonly performs in a few phases:
To set up honeypots in Ethereum good contracts, an attacker does not need any certain capabilities. An attacker, in fact, has the same competencies as a normal Ethereum user. They only will need the revenue to set up the good agreement and bait it. A honeypot operation, in basic, is composed of a computer system, applications and info that mimic the behavior of a serious procedure that may be pleasing to attackers, these as World wide web of Issues units, a banking technique, or a public utility or transit community.
Even although it looks like a component of the community, it is isolated and monitored. Mainly because legit consumers have no motive to access a honeypot, all makes an attempt to talk with it are regarded as hostile. Honeypots are often deployed in a network’s demilitarized zone (DMZ). This system separates it from the major creation network even though trying to keep it related. A honeypot in the DMZ might be monitored from afar whilst attackers entry it, decreasing the risk of a compromised most important network.
To detect attempts to infiltrate the inner community, honeypots can be positioned outside the house the exterior firewall, experiencing the net. The actual location of the honeypot relies upon on how intricate it is, the variety of site visitors it wishes to entice and how shut it is to crucial business enterprise resources. It will always be isolated from the output atmosphere, no matter of the place it is put.
Logging and viewing honeypot exercise provides insight into the degree and sorts of threats that a community infrastructure confronts even though diverting attackers’ consideration absent from authentic-globe belongings. Honeypots can be taken in excess of by cybercriminals and made use of towards the organization that established them up. Cybercriminals have also utilised honeypots to get hold of details on scientists or organizations, serve as decoys and propagate misinformation.
Honeypots are commonly hosted on virtual equipment. For case in point, if the honeypot is compromised by malware, it can be quickly restored. For instance, a honeynet is designed up of two or far more honeypots on a community, while a honey farm is a centralized selection of honeypots and assessment tools.
Honeypot deployment and administration can be aided by equally open source and business answers. Honeypot devices that are bought individually and honeypots that are combined with other stability program and marketed as deception technologies are obtainable. Honeypot software program may well be observed on GitHub, which can aid newcomers in understanding how to use honeypots.
Kinds of honeypots
There are two forms of honeypots centered on the structure and deployment of sensible contracts: exploration and manufacturing honeypots. Honeypots for exploration gather information and facts on attacks and are utilised to evaluate hostile conduct in the wild.
They get data on attacker tendencies, vulnerabilities and malware strains that adversaries are at present targeting by hunting at each your setting and the outdoors globe. This info can assistance you make a decision on preventative defenses, patch priorities and foreseeable future investments.
On the other hand, manufacturing honeypots are aimed at detecting lively community penetration and deceiving the attacker. Honeypots offer extra monitoring prospects and fill in frequent detection gaps that encompass determining network scans and lateral movement consequently, getting knowledge remains a top duty.
Generation honeypots run solutions that would typically operate in your natural environment alongside the rest of your generation servers. Honeypots for research are additional intricate and shop far more facts varieties than honeypots for generation.
There are also numerous tiers within creation and exploration honeypots, depending on the amount of sophistication your business demands:
Large-conversation honeypot: This is similar to a pure honeypot in that it operates a massive quantity of solutions, but it is considerably less sophisticated and retains much less information. While superior-conversation honeypots are not intended to replicate complete-scale generation techniques, they operate (or look to operate) all of the services commonly associated with output techniques, such as functioning working systems.
The deploying organization can observe attacker habits and strategies utilizing this honeypot kind. Substantial-interaction honeypots want a lot of methods and are difficult to keep, but the final results can be value it.
Mid-conversation honeypot: These imitate traits of the application layer but deficiency their functioning process. They try to interfere or perplex attackers so that companies have additional time to determine out how to react appropriately to an assault.Lower-conversation honeypot: This is the most well-liked honeypot utilised in a output ecosystem. Lower-conversation honeypots operate a couple of products and services and are generally made use of as an early warning detection software. Quite a few safety groups set up numerous honeypots across distinct segments of their community simply because they are simple to set up and sustain.Pure honeypot: This substantial-scale, production-like program operates on various servers. It is whole of sensors and contains “confidential” knowledge and user facts. The information and facts they offer is priceless, even although it can be complex and demanding to control.
Numerous honeypot technologies
The following are some of the honeypot technologies in use:
Client honeypots: The the vast majority of honeypots are servers that are listening for connections. Consumer honeypots actively lookup out malicious servers that concentrate on clientele, and they preserve an eye on the honeypot for any suspicious or unforeseen changes. These methods are commonly virtualized and have a containment plan in place to retain the exploration team protected.Malware honeypots: These establish malware by employing set up replication and attack channels. Honeypots (these kinds of as Ghost) have been made to glance like USB storage devices. For instance, if a equipment becomes infected with malware that spreads by USB, the honeypot will deceive the malware into infecting the simulated unit.Honeynets: A honeynet is a network of a number of honeypots fairly than a solitary procedure. Honeynets are created to adhere to an attacker’s actions and motives even though containing all inbound and outbound communication.Open up mail relays and open proxies are simulated employing spam honeypots. Spammers will first ship by themselves an e mail to check the out there mail relay. If they are effective, they will deliver out a remarkable volume of spam. This kind of honeypot can detect and identify the check and productively block the massive volume of spam that follows.Database honeypot: Because structured question language injections can usually go undetected by firewalls, some companies will deploy a databases firewall to make decoy databases and give honeypot guidance.
How to spot a crypto honeypot?
Analyzing the trade heritage is one method to recognize a honeypot crypto fraud. A cryptocurrency need to commonly enable you to invest in and offer it whenever you drive. There will be a good deal of buys for the coin in a honeypot scam, but men and women will have a tricky time offering it. This signifies that it is not a respectable coin, and you must keep away from it.
What’s more, the info science tactic based mostly on the contract transaction behavior can be utilized to classify contracts as honeypots or non-honeypots.
Wherever can honeypots crop up in Ethereum clever contracts?
Honeypots could possibly look in a few diverse parts of Ethereum clever contracts implementation. These are the three ranges:
The Etheruem digital machine (EVM)- Although the EVM follows a well-set up established of criteria and principles, clever agreement writers can present their code in techniques that are deceptive or unclear at first glance. These tactics could possibly be costly for the unsuspecting hacker.The solidity compiler-The compiler is the next location where by good deal builders may possibly capitalize. Even though specific compiler-stage bugs are effectively-documented, other people may perhaps not be. These honeypots can be tricky to learn except if the agreement has been analyzed under true-planet options.The Etherscan blockchain explorer-The 3rd type of honeypot is based on the actuality that the facts introduced on blockchain explorers is incomplete. Though quite a few folks implicitly consider Etherscan’s knowledge, it would not essentially exhibit the entire photo. On the other hand, wily clever deal builders can acquire benefit of some of the explorer’s quirks.
How to shield from honeypot contract cons?
This section guides how to get out of the honeypot ripoffs to prevent shedding your funds. There are resources readily available to help you in viewing pink signals and keeping away from these currencies. For instance, use Etherscan if the coin you might be acquiring is on the Ethereum network or use BscScan if the coin under consideration is on the Binance Clever Chain.
Uncover out your coin’s Token ID and enter it on the correct web site. Go to “Token Tracker” on the next website page. A tab labeled “Holders” will surface. You can see all of the wallets that keep tokens and the liquidity swimming pools there. However, there are several combinations of objects of which to be mindful. The adhering to are some of the red flags that you should know to guard towards honeypot crypto scams:
No lifeless coins: If a lot more than 50% of cash are in a dead wallet, a challenge is somewhat guarded from rug pulls (but not a honeypot) (usually recognized as 0x000000000000000000000000000000000000dead). If significantly less than 50 % of the cash are dead or none are lifeless, be cautious.No audit: The prospects of a honeypot are nearly often removed if a dependable enterprise audits them.Massive wallets holders: Steer clear of cryptocurrencies that have only a single or a couple wallets.Scrutinize their internet site: This must be really uncomplicated but, if the web-site seems rushed and the progress is bad, this is a warning indication! 1 trick is to go to whois.domaintools.com and style in the area name to see when it was registered for a web site. You could possibly be fairly certain it can be a fraud if the area was registered inside 24 hours or much less of the project’s start off.Check their social media: Fraud assignments usually element stolen and very low-high quality pics, grammatical problems and unappealing “spammy messages” (these types of as “fall your ETH tackle below!”), no hyperlinks to pertinent venture facts and so on.
Token Sniffer is a further outstanding source to spot honeypot crypto. Look for the “Automated Contract Audit” final results by moving into the Token ID in the top rated correct corner. Continue to be absent from the challenge if there are any alerts. Mainly because numerous projects now utilize deal templates, the “No prior similar token contracts” indication can be a false positive.
If your coin is detailed on the Binance Clever Chain, go to PooCoin, enter the Token ID all over again and watch the charts. Remain absent if there usually are not any wallets offering or if only one or two wallets are providing your picked out coin. Most most likely, it truly is a honeypot. It really is not a honeypot if numerous wallets are marketing the decided on coin. Last of all, you ought to carry out thorough research in advance of parting with your tough-earned income when getting cryptocurrencies.
How is a honeypot distinctive from a honeynet?
A honeynet is a community designed up of two or a lot more honeypots. It can be beneficial to have a honeypot community that is connected. It allows companies to observe how an attacker interacts with a solitary resource or network point and how an invader moves among network factors and interacts with many details at at the time.
The intention is to persuade hackers that they have properly breached the network thus, adding far more bogus community spots to the realism of the arrangement. Honeypots and honeynets with far more highly developed implementations, these types of as upcoming-technology firewalls, intrusion detection units (IDSes), and secure world-wide-web gateways, are referred to as deception technologies. Intrusion detection devices refer to a device or software program application that watches for hostile action or coverage breaches on a community. Automated abilities of deception technological innovation allow a honeypot to reply to opportunity attackers in genuine-time.
Honeypots can help corporations in retaining up with the at any time-modifying hazard landscape as cyber threats emerge. Honeypots supply important details to make certain an business is geared up and are probably the very best signifies to catch an attacker in the act, even nevertheless it is difficult to forecast and avoid each individual assault. They’re also a fantastic supply of understanding for cybersecurity pros.
What are the execs and cons of honeypots?
Honeypots gather facts from authentic assaults and other illicit action, giving analysts a prosperity of expertise. Moreover, there are much less wrong positives. For case in point, ordinary cybersecurity detection methods can make lots of false positives, but a honeypot minimizes the quantity of fake positives since genuine buyers have no motive to call the honeypot.
In addition, honeypots are worthwhile investments because they only interact with harmful actions and do not demand superior-effectiveness methods to procedure huge volumes of community information in research of attacks. And finally, even if an attacker is applying encryption, honeypots can detect malicious activities.
Though honeypots present a lot of pros, they also have a whole lot of negatives and challenges. For instance, honeypots only gather facts in the party of an attack. There have been no tries to obtain the honeypot as a result, no knowledge exists to examine the attack.
In addition, malicious site visitors acquired by the honeypot community is only collected when an attack is introduced against it if an attacker suspects a community is a honeypot, they will keep away from it.
Honeypots are generally recognizable from lawful generation techniques, which indicates that competent hackers can quickly distinguish a production method from a honeypot method working with process fingerprinting procedures.
Despite the actuality that honeypots are isolated from the authentic community, they ultimately join in some way to permit administrators to accessibility the info they hold. Because it seeks to entice hackers to get root accessibility, a large-interaction honeypot is often deemed riskier than a very low-conversation a single.
All round, honeypots aid researchers in understanding risks in network systems, but they ought to not be utilized in position of regular IDS. For case in point, if a honeypot isn’t established up accurately, it may possibly be exploited to receive access to genuine-world methods or a launchpad for assaults on other programs.